What is the probability that Julio will select a strawberry candy from the first bag and a tamarind candy from the second bag during his next draw?

Short Answer

The probability of selecting a strawberry candy from the first bag is 7/20, while the probability of selecting a tamarind candy from the second bag is 3/10. The combined probability of these independent selections is 0.105 or 10.5%.

Step-by-Step Solution

Step 1: Calculate Probability from the First Bag

Start by determining the total number of candies in the first bag. The breakdown of candies is:

  • Pineapple: 8
  • Lime: 5
  • Strawberry: 7
The total comes to 20 candies. To find the probability of selecting a strawberry candy, divide the number of strawberry candies (7) by the total (20), yielding a probability of 7/20.

Step 2: Calculate Probability from the Second Bag

Next, assess the second bag’s total candy count. The quantities are:

  • Mango: 1
  • Tamarind: 3
  • Watermelon: 6
This totals to 10 candies. The probability for selecting a tamarind candy is found by dividing the number of tamarind candies (3) by 10, which results in a probability of 3/10.

Step 3: Calculate the Combined Probability

Since the events of selecting candies from each bag are independent, the combined probability is calculated by multiplying the two probabilities derived earlier:

  • First bag: 7/20
  • Second bag: 3/10
Thus, the combined probability is (7/20) * (3/10) = 0.105 or 10.5%.

Related Concepts

Probability

Defining the likelihood of an event occurring, expressed as a ratio or fraction of favorable outcomes to total possible outcomes

Independent events

Events where the occurrence of one does not affect the occurrence of another

Combined probability

The probability of two or more independent events occurring together, calculated by multiplying their individual probabilities.
